Q1. Why is understanding the peanut growth cycle important?
Peanuts pass through several stages:
Vegetative Stage (0–35 Days)
Development of:
-
Roots
-
Nodules
-
Leaves
-
Stems
Reproductive Stage (35–120 Days)
Development of:
-
Flowering
-
Peg formation
-
Pod development
-
Seed filling
-
Maturity
Healthy vegetative growth establishes the foundation for maximum yield and pod quality.

Q2. What is the ideal soil for peanut production?
Peanuts grow best in:
- Sandy loam to loamy soils
- Good drainage
- pH 5.8–7.0
- High organic matter
Avoid:
- Waterlogging
- Soil compaction
- Salinity

Q6. How can MicrobeBio help control peanut diseases?
Major diseases include:
-
Early leaf spot
-
Late leaf spot
-
Rust
-
Stem rot
-
Southern blight
-
Rhizoctonia
-
Pythium
-
Aspergillus flavus
-
Aflatoxin contamination
